Bottom line: Continue for software development teams wanting configurable AI tooling; Tabnine for enterprise engineering teams with strict privacy and compliance requirements.

Continue is an open-source AI coding assistant that brings autocomplete, in-IDE chat, and agentic edits to VS Code and JetBrains, with support for any model.

Pros
  • Open-source foundation gives teams full transparency into how the assistant behaves and the freedom to adapt it to their own workflows.
  • Works across major editors including VS Code and JetBrains, fitting into existing developer environments rather than forcing a tool switch.
  • Custom AI agents can be source-controlled and shared, letting teams encode their own standards and reuse consistent automation across projects.
  • Flexible model access through a credit system means teams can choose frontier models that match their needs instead of being locked to one provider.
  • Integrations with Slack, Sentry, and Snyk extend AI assistance beyond the editor into the wider development and incident workflow.
  • Exceptionally flexible deployment, including SaaS, VPC, on-premises, and fully air-gapped options with zero data retention, which is rare among AI coding assistants and a genuine differentiator for regulated industries.
  • Bring-your-own-model support lets teams connect their own on-prem or cloud LLM endpoints and switch chat models, avoiding lock-in to a single proprietary model and enabling unlimited usage when running your own LLM.
  • The Enterprise Context Engine grounds completions and agents in an organization's real codebase and conventions, producing suggestions that reflect actual architecture rather than generic patterns.
  • IP-protection tooling such as code provenance and attribution plus license-compliant models directly addresses copyright and compliance concerns that block many enterprises from adopting AI coding tools.
  • Broad coverage across the SDLC through inline completions, in-IDE chat, agentic workflows, and a CLI, all working across major IDEs and many programming languages.
Cons
  • The recent acquisition by Cursor creates uncertainty around the product's future direction, subscription continuity, and long-term roadmap.
  • A credit-based model billing structure can make spend less predictable than a flat subscription, especially for teams using premium frontier models heavily.
  • Building and tuning custom agents requires upfront configuration effort and a degree of technical comfort that casual users may find demanding.
  • Post-acquisition, the long-term status of standalone hosting and the open-source project may shift, introducing potential lock-in or migration concerns.
  • Self-hosting the privacy-focused tier carries meaningful infrastructure overhead, with GPU and operational costs that can substantially exceed the per-seat price for teams with strict data-residency needs.
  • Pricing can be hard to predict when using Tabnine-provided model access, since token consumption is billed at LLM provider rates plus a handling fee on top of the per-seat fee.
  • Raw completion and chat quality on the base models has historically trailed some cloud-first rivals that lean on the largest frontier models, so teams optimizing purely for suggestion quality should benchmark carefully.
  • The full value depends on configuring context, models, and deployment correctly, which adds setup complexity compared with plug-and-play consumer coding assistants.
